Storing intermediate time
You can store an intermediate time while the
stopwatch is still running.
1. Main menu "Chrono"
2. Select "Int."
and confirm.
The intermediate time is displayed temporarily
on the multi-function display. It is not stored.
Timing continues in the background.
Stopping timing
You can stop the stopwatch at any time.
1. Main menu "Chrono"
2. Select "Stop"
and confirm.
The stopwatch time B stops.
Continuing timing
You can resume timing again after stopping the
stopwatch.
1. Main menu "Chrono"
> "Stop"
2. "Res."
and confirm.
The stopwatch time B continues.
Resetting the stopwatch time
The stopwatch time can be reset to zero.
1. Main menu "Chrono"
> "Stop"
2. Select "Reset"
and confirm.
All stopwatch time displays are reset to zero.

G-Force Menu

In the "G-Force" main menu, the current lateral
and longitudinal acceleration forces are shown
graphically in the form of a circular diagram.
The maximum occurring longitudinal and lateral
acceleration forces are displayed in the "G-Force
max" sub-menu.
The values can be reset via the menu item
"Reset".
1. "G-Force" main menu
2. Confirm "G-Force max".
3. "Reset"
and confirm.

Performance Menu

Torque
In the "Performance" main menu, the current
torque is displayed graphically as a function of
engine speed.
When "Sport" or "Sport Plus" mode is activated,
the additional on-demand torque (overboost
function) appears as a white area in the curve.

1. Main menu "Performance"
2. Select "Torque"
and confirm.
